Interpretation

"One & Only" by HASEUL (LOONA) is a delicate, emotionally luminous solo turn that highlights the gentle, comforting quality that made her a beloved leader and vocal presence in the group. The production favors softness — airy synths, light percussion, and a dreamy, mid-tempo arrangement that wraps the listener in warmth rather than demanding attention. HASEUL's voice is the heart of the piece: clear, sweet, and tender, with a sincere, slightly vulnerable timbre that conveys care and quiet strength. The emotional landscape is one of reassurance and devotion — the title speaks to singularity, to telling someone they are irreplaceable, the one and only. Lyrically it leans warm and affirming, the kind of message that doubles as a love song and a comfort to listeners, especially meaningful given HASEUL's deep bond with fans through her own personal struggles. Culturally it sits within the LOONA universe's tradition of ethereal, concept-rich pop while standing on its own as an accessible, heartfelt ballad-pop hybrid.
